What Are Minecraft Quests?

Minecraft quests are objectives or tasks players undertake within the game. These missions vary from simple challenges like gathering resources to complex narratives involving battles against mobs and solving puzzles. Players can follow a quest line to discover hidden treasures or complete tasks for NPCs. Completing quests often rewards players with valuable items, experience points, or unique achievements.

Player-Created Quests

Community creativity elevates Minecraft quests through player-generated content. Players utilize command blocks, redstone mechanics, and unique storytelling to craft intricate quest experiences. They design maps where participants complete challenges and navigate puzzles, fostering innovation and collaboration. Websites and forums often serve as platforms for sharing these quests, allowing others to discover and participate in diverse adventures. Common Challenges and Solutions

Players may encounter various challenges during quests. Resource scarcity can hinder progress; therefore, farming essential items beforehand helps mitigate this issue. Confusion about quest objectives often arises; reviewing quest logs provides clarity. Difficulty in combat scenarios may lead to frustration; utilizing teamwork and developing combat strategies can improve outcomes. Lastly, technical issues such as lag can disrupt gameplay, but lowering graphics settings or optimizing internet connections often resolves these problems.
